QUESTION 14 In a non-instantaneous receipt model (i.e., production run model), daily demand is 40 units and daily production is 100 units, Co-$50 and Ch-$3 per unityear. The production facility operates 300 days per year. Assume the optimal production quantity is 817. What is the maximum inventory level? Maximum inventory level= Q (1-d/p)

Q- order quantity, here, taken as optimal production quantity

d-daily demand in units

p-daily production capacity in units

Maximum inventory level = 817 (1- 40/100)

= 490.2 units

Therefore option (c) is correct
